
THE FACTS: Seminole Intercollegiate
2/21/2020 12:00:00 PM | Men's Golf
FIRST TEE — No. 32-ranked North Florida returns to the course for a second consecutive week as the Ospreys are set to play in the Seminole Intercollegiate at Golden Eagle Country Club starting on Saturday.

1. LAST TIME OUT: North Florida struggled at the Gator Invitational last weekend finishing 10th of 15 teams | Junior Michael Saccente was a bright spot for the Osprey earning a T18 finish highlighted by his final round 68

2. COURSE REPORT: Golden Eagle Country Club will be played with par 72, 6,965-yard layout for the Seminole Intercollegiate | North Florida is making its inaugural appearance in the event | UNF is not a stranger to Golden Eagle CC having earned the 2013 NCAA Tallahassee Regional crown with a 34-under total of 830Â
3. OSPREY LINE-UP (2019-20 stroke average): Senior Michael Mattiace (71.89) | Freshman Davis Lee (71.89) | Sophomore Cody Carroll (72.67) | Redshirt senior Nick Infanti (72.06) | Redshirt junior Michael Saccente (73.11) | The tournament consists of 36-holes of play Saturday (Feb. 22) followed by a final round of 18 holes Sunday (Feb. 23) | Saturday's opening day features a shotgun start at 8 a.m. with Ospreys paired alongside Liberty and West Virginia starting on Holes 5-8
4. THE FIELDÂ (# indicates current Golfstat Top 100 ranking):Â Participating squads in the 14-team field include: Chattanooga, #25 ETSU, #46 Florida State, Jacksonville, #45 James Madison, #56 Kent State, #33 Liberty, North Alabama, #32 North Florida, South Alabama, Southern Illinois, Troy, #17 Washington, #47 West Virginia | Field featues 7 teams listed in the Top 50
5. SCHROEDER SAYS...Â
"We have a quick turnaround for us and we need to bounce back and play better. We are going to a course that I have good memories from our NCAA Regional win, but unfortunately that does nothing for our team this week. It will be important to drive the ball well and be patient in some challenging conditions." - Head coach Scott Schroeder
Coming Up Next - Following back-to-back weeks with a tournament, North Florida will enjoy a few weeks off before returning to competition Mar. 9-10 at the General Hackler Championship in Myrtle Beach, S.C.
